23 Oakington Avenue, Amersham, HP6 6SY is a freehold detached property built between 1950-1966. The property offers approximately 753 square feet of living space. In this location, properties of similar size usually have two bedrooms.

The estimated current market value of the property is £648,452 , which equates to approximately £861 per square foot. It was last sold on 6 Jul 2011 for £387,000. Since then, the value has increased by £261,452, representing a 67.6% increase, or approximately 4.7% per year.

23 Oakington Avenue, Amersham, Chiltern, Buckinghamshire, HP6 6SY has an Energy Performance Certificate (EPC) rating of D, based on the latest assessment carried out on 11 Mar 2014.

This property uses a gas-fired boiler and radiators, connected to the mains gas supply, as its main heating source. Hot water is provided from the main heating system, though the cylinder has no thermostat. The windows are fully double glazed.

The previous EPC assessment was conducted on 17 Feb 2011, when the property was rated E. Since then, the rating has improved to D, with the energy efficiency score increasing by 14.6%.

Since the previous assessment, several changes were observed:

  • The main heating energy efficiency changing from very good to good, while the heating system type remained the same (boiler and radiators, mains gas).
  • The hot water system was changed from from main system to from main system, no cylinder thermostat, with its energy efficiency changing from very good to average.
  • The roof construction or insulation changed from pitched, no insulation (assumed) to pitched, 150 mm loft insulation, improving energy efficiency from very poor to good.
  • The lighting was updated from no low energy lighting to low energy lighting in 43% of fixed outlets, with efficiency improving from very poor to average.
